Andrew M. Chase is a Director at Cushman & Wakefield. In this role, Mr. Chase provides negotiation and advisory services, using his comprehensive knowledge as an expert in the New York City real estate market combined with the broad range of resources at Cushman & Wakefield. Mr. Chase has worked with clients around the world comprising a broad range of sizes in the finance, law, technology, media, advertising, and nonprofit sectors to plan and execute corporate real estate strategy; including lease renewals, expansions, relocations, and consolidations. In addition, Mr. Chase has advised on the purchase and sale of commercial properties. Mr. Chase graduated from the Maxwell School of Citizenship and Public Affairs at Syracuse University with a Bachelor of Arts degree. At Syracuse, he was a member of the Phi Eta Sigma Honors Fraternity and the Men’s Ice Hockey Team. Mr. Chase is a licensed real estate salesperson in the state of New York and a member of the Real Estate Board of New York. He is also an active member of the Plaza, Grand Central, Midtown West/Penn Plaza, Midtown South, and Lower Manhattan Committees.
